The Role
Reporting into senior finance leadership, you’ll oversee the end-to-end payroll function, ensuring payroll is delivered accurately, compliantly and on time while leading a small payroll team.
This role goes far beyond processing payroll. You’ll be responsible for reviewing and enhancing payroll processes, improving controls, leading systems developments and acting as the organisation’s subject matter expert on payroll legislation and employment taxes
Key Responsibilities
*Manage multiple monthly payrolls, ensuring accurate and timely processing.
*Review payroll outputs, reconciliations and controls prior to sign-off.
*Oversee payroll accounting, reconciliations and month-end reporting.
*Ensure compliance with UK payroll legislation, HMRC requirements, pensions and employment taxes.
*Lead payroll audits and act as the key contact for external auditors.
*Drive payroll process improvements, automation and system enhancements.
*Lead the implementation of mandatory payrolling of benefits ahead of future legislative changes.
*Provide expert payroll advice to Finance, HR and senior stakeholders.
*Develop, coach and support the payroll team.
*Maintain strong financial controls and continuously improve payroll governance.
About You
We’re looking for someone who combines strong technical payroll knowledge with excellent leadership and stakeholder management skills.
You’ll ideally have:
*CIPP qualification (or equivalent).
*Significant experience managing payroll within a large or complex organisation.
*Strong knowledge of UK payroll legislation, employment taxes and HMRC compliance.
*Experience leading payroll process improvements and system implementations.
*Previous responsibility for payroll reconciliations, controls and audit support.
*Advanced Excel skills.
*Experience using payroll systems such as Workday, Access Payroll or similar.
*Strong leadership, organisation and communication skills.
